PC-Based DVRs vs Standalone DVRs

As the name implies, a PC-based DVR is a computer that is running DVR software and has the ability to accept video and audio feeds from a security camera system thanks to a dedicated add-on card. Such a setup is typically more expensive than a standalone DVR unit, but there are advantages to the added cost.

What are Infrared Lights and How Do They Work?

Once upon a time in the early days of security cameras, there was no such thing as an “infrared” camera. In other words, unless you had a source of light illuminating the area your security camera was aimed at – either from the sun during the day or a floodlight, spotlight or some other type of light at night – you weren’t actually going to record anything.

What is Firmware and How Does It Work?

What is Firmware and How Does It Work?

Firmware is drastically different than normal pieces of software that run on your computer or your mobile device as there’s usually no way to auto-update the firmware on a piece of hardware. Compare this to how your computer’s operating system is constantly downloading updates and then installing them whenever you reset, or how your mobile phone regularly updates its installed apps to the most recent version released by the developer, and you’ll see that firmware differs in a fundamental way.
